One of our core strengths is precision machining of die-casted aluminum parts. Die casting allows us to efficiently create complex shapes with excellent dimensional stability, but the true value emerges when secondary CNC machining is applied to enhance detail and functionality. For example, our custom die-casted and CNC machined aluminum gearmotor parts start with a high-quality die-casting process followed by meticulous machining of internal surfaces. This combination ensures tight tolerances and smooth finishes essential for gearmotor assemblies, which require both durability and precision.

Investment casting provides an unmatched ability to produce parts with intricate details and superior surface quality. After casting, parts undergo secondary machining processes to achieve specific dimensional accuracy and add essential features such as chamfers, threads, or holes.
Take, for instance, our custom investment casted wing nuts. These are initially produced through investment casting, then precisely machined to include chamfers before receiving a protective zinc plating finish. This process not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also provides excellent corrosion resistance—making these components well-suited for demanding mechanical assemblies in aerospace, machinery, and construction industries.
For components requiring structural assembly and enhanced mechanical properties, we combine casting, welding, and surface finishing to produce complex parts that perform reliably in demanding environments.
Our custom aluminum welded flexarm components exemplify this advanced manufacturing approach. Starting from die-cast aluminum parts, we perform precision welding to join multiple segments, creating flexible and sturdy assemblies. The final step includes black anodizing, providing a durable, corrosion-resistant surface finish that enhances the component’s lifespan and wear resistance.

Surface finishing is no longer an afterthought; it plays a pivotal role in component performance and longevity. We offer a variety of finishing options, including galvanizing, anodizing, and oxidation treatments, tailored to enhance both the appearance and durability of mechanical parts.
Our integrated finishing capabilities are particularly beneficial when combined with casting and welding processes. For instance, zinc plating on investment casted parts ensures corrosion resistance without compromising mechanical integrity. Similarly, black anodizing on welded aluminum assemblies provides an attractive, durable surface that withstands environmental stress.
